📅  最后修改于: 2023-12-03 15:09:06.129000             🧑  作者: Mango
如果您正在使用 Kali Linux 操作系统并且需要将 Python 2 更新为 Python 3,则可以遵循以下步骤:
在终端中输入以下命令以确认已安装 Python 3:
python3 -V
如果已安装,应该会返回 Python 3.x.x 的版本号。如果未安装,则需要先安装 Python 3。
在更新 Python 之前,最好更新系统并安装一些必要的依赖项。在终端中运行以下命令:
sudo apt update
sudo apt upgrade
sudo apt install build-essential libssl-dev libffi-dev python3-dev
这将更新您的系统并安装一些必要的依赖项,以便后续步骤可以顺利进行。
接下来,我们需要使用 pip(Python 包管理器)安装 Python 3。在终端中运行以下命令:
sudo apt install python3-pip
这将安装 pip 以及一些必要的工具。
在你开始升级之前,你需要确认你已经安装了和Python 2 相关的包。在终端中运行以下命令:
pip freeze | grep "^M2Crypto=\|^pyOpenSSL==\|^ndg-httpsclient==\|pyasn1==" | cut -d= -f1 | xargs sudo pip install -U
这会升级 M2Crypto、pyOpenSSL、ndg-httpsclient 和 pyasn1 四个模块至最新版本,以确保它们可以兼容 Python 3。
现在,您可以使用 pip3 安装任何需要的 Python 3 模块。例如,如果您要安装 Requests 库,可以运行以下命令:
sudo pip3 install requests
这会使用 Python 3 版本的 pip 安装 Requests 库。
现在,您已经成功将 Kali Linux 操作系统从 Python 2 更新为 Python 3,并安装了必要的依赖项和模块。要使用 Python 3,请在终端中运行以下命令:
python3
这会启动 Python 3 解释器。现在,您可以使用 Python 3 编写和运行代码了。
以上就是将 Kali Linux 操作系统从 Python 2 更新为 Python 3 的完整步骤。